The islands of the Republic of the Philippines have many natural resources that could aid in making this new Disney Park which include timber, petroleum, nickel, cobalt, silver, gold, salt, and copper. With its abundance of forests, over 46% of the Philippines are woodlands; there will be more than enough wood to build rides and/or buildings. The Philippines also have many ways of getting electricity to power the Park. For example, it has hydropower, fossil fuels, and various other ways. Also, some of the Philippines major industries are electronic and electrical products so there should be no problem getting electricity anywhere in the Park.
There are many different forms of transportation available to people on these islands. Out of the 199,950 kilometers of highway, 39,590 kilometers are paved, 3,219 kilometers of waterways, 76 airports with paved runways, and many ports and harbors. In total, there are 459 merchant marine ships, which can carry just about anything from cargo, livestock, passengers, and vehicles. There are also 212 total airports with unpaved runways so that when more tourists come, the airplanes can land there as well as at the airports with paved runways.
The people who will be working on building this new Disney Park will be quite educated. By 1988 the literacy rate was 88% nation wide. 56% of the people nation wide are enrolled in high school and enrollment in institutions of higher learning exceeded 1.6 million in the late 1980’s and is increasing. Filipinos consider education to be its primary path towards a better society and economic mobility and are using the United States as a model for its educational system. Language should not be a problem since on of the two officials languages of the Philippines is English. Also, the life expectancy rate is about 67.8 years with a birth rate of 27.37 births per 1,000 people and a population growth rate of 2.03%. The labor force is approximately 48.1 million, 5.8% of which are construction workers. There is a 10% unemployment rate that the government would like to decrease, and the construction of this park would help give many people jobs, which would help this country’s economy.
